Output d7a4a950c161da4a68d08d83702021d6c02d12baba890c4237b3dca01e8537ee:0

value
31084412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517b794c23f91bd5e47041fbba8aceee6c8201b3 OP_EQUAL
address
MFKzt5aUVxWhNtHqedtwoF7cudJ7dbPz4U
transaction
d7a4a950c161da4a68d08d83702021d6c02d12baba890c4237b3dca01e8537ee
spent
true